Thiago Silva signs new Chelsea contract until 2024
Chelsea have confirmed that Thiago Silva has signed a new contract with the club.

The Brazilian’s deal was set to expire at the end of the season, and he was eligible to speak to foreign clubs about a free transfer in the summer.

But the Blues confirmed on Friday night that Silva has extended his contract by another 12 months, tying him to the club until 2024.

Silva said in a statement: “I am honestly so happy to continue my career with the Blues.

“When I signed my first contract here, it was to just do one year. Now it is already the fourth! I could not have imagined that, but really it is a very special moment for me to sign and stay at Chelsea.”

In a joint statement, co-owners Todd Boehly and Behdad Eghbali said: “We’re delighted that Thiago has decided to continue with Chelsea.

“He’s a world-class talent, as he’s proven over many years for club and country, and his experience, quality and leadership skills are vital to our vision going forward.

“We’re thrilled he has extended his contract with us and we look forward to more success with him ahead!”
